The most common kind of window frame for double-glazed windows is u, PVC (unplasticised polyvinyl chloride, to give it its complete name).

u, PVC doors and window frames are available in a range of colours and finishes, including wood, though they're most typically white. u, PVC is simple to keep tidy, too, needing little bit more than a clean down with a soft cloth and a spot of washing-up liquid every from time to time.

Lots of people feel wood windows look better and more subtle than u, PVC, especially in traditional or period-style residential or commercial properties. While wood windows tend to be more expensive and need maintenance, they can last a very long time if effectively taken care of. Aluminium is a very strong product, so its windows are durable and low maintenance.
